Security At Thai Airports

Featured Replies

As a result of the takeover of the BKK airports, you would think that security would be beefed up at the other major Thai airports. Maybe some heavily armed police at the airport entrance?

At my local international airport, which was overrun with PAD protesters a few months ago, I have not seen any visible increase in airport security at all. Nothing at all. It's almost as if the police/AOT are inviting PAD to occupy the airport.

That worries me. Not only because this airport seems 'open-door' for PAD protesters, but perhaps also 'open-door' for terrorist attack.

I don't like it, but there is nought that I can do about it.
